Hi Laura! I'm eager to try dyeing with barks, and I have a question about it. I found an old paper (Home Dyeing with Natural Dyes by Margaret S Furry) about dyeing with different media. It says that barks have tannins that turn the fiber darker over time, so you need to use a post-dye chemical to halt that color change. But the chemicals seem super-toxic and I'd rather not use it in my apartment kitchen. Did you see a color change for any of your bark-dyed yarns? Thanks in advance!
